Galileo接收机中窄相关技术的分析与研究

摘    要:将窄相关技术应用到Galileo系统中进行分析和研究具有非常实际的意义。主要介绍了Galileo信号的基本结构,根据延迟锁相环的基本结构分析了其多径误差函数。通过对跟踪误差函数方差的仿真分析,可以看出窄相关技术对跟踪误差有很好的抑制能力,能提高测量精度。

Study on narrow correlator technology based on Galileo receiver

Abstract:Applying the narrow correlator technology to the Galileo system is of practical value. The basic structure of Galileo signal was introduced, and based on the structure of delay lock loop, the error function of the multipath was analyzed. The simulation results of the variance of the tracking error function indicate that the tracking error is mostly mitigated, and the precision of the tracking is enhanced.
